Unable to connect the VPN after upgraded the Forticlient VPN from 7.4.3 to 7.4.5 managed by EMS

  • April 8, 2026
  • 2 replies
  • 321 views

Dear Team,

One of our customer upgraded the FortiClient version from 7.4.3 to 7.4.5 which is managed by EMS.

After that most of the users facing to connect the VPN.

By default, the FortiClient installer contains 9 VPN URLs or Gateway defined in EMS.

When the user tried to connect any of the VPN gateway by clicking 'connect' button it does not react anything.

For some users, the issue resolved by reinstalling the FortiClient, Re-register the zero trust telemetry with invitation code, restarting the laptop and connecting to different Wifi or network.

For few users, did not helped any of the above workaround.

From the user machine we collected the FortiClient log and found below logs.

Could any one help with below logs to sort out the issue.
